自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(22)
  • 收藏
  • 关注

转载 Layout_weight

android:layout_weight的真实含义是: 一旦View设置了该属性(假设有效的情况下),那么该 View的宽度等于原有宽度(android:layout_width)加上剩余空间的占比!<LinearLayout android:layout_width="match_parent" android:layout_height="wrap_content"

2016-06-14 15:05:32 309

原创 Volley使用笔记(二)

JsonRequest的用法与StringRequest相似。JsonObjectRequest jsonObjectRequest = new JsonObjectRequest("http://m.weather.com.cn/data/101010100.html", null, new Response.Listener<JSONObject>() {

2016-06-14 03:11:54 302

原创 Volley使用笔记(一)

以StringRequest为例: 首先需要获取到一个RequestQueue对象,这是一个请求队列,缓存所有的HTTP请求,然后按照一定的算法并发地发出这些请求。RequestQueue mQueue = Volley.newRequestQueue(context); 为了要发出一条HTTP请求,我们还需要创建一个StringRequest对象。参数分别是url,成功返回,失败返回。Stri

2016-06-13 17:47:52 467

转载 基本排序算法学习记录

学习自http://www.codeceo.com/article/10-sort-algorithm-interview.html1、冒泡排序                   通过与相邻元素的比较和交换来把小的数交换到最前面。从后向前冒泡,如果比前一个数小就与前一位交换位置直到遇到比自己少的数。对5,3,8,6,4这个无序序列进行冒泡排序。首先从后向前冒泡,4和6比较,把4交

2016-03-07 17:13:05 371

原创 GuideMap 登陆界面 详细文档(四)

七、RegisterActivity 注册类 · 1、初始化控件 initControls() 2、初始化载入中界面 initLoginingDlg() 3、点击事件 onClick() 4、编辑框文本输入 PutInData() 5、显示载入中界面 private void showLoginingDlg

2016-03-05 23:21:34 434

原创 GuideMap 登录界面 详细文档(三)

五、LoginActivity 登录类1、获取已经保存好的用户密码 private void getSavedUsers()2、初始化 private void initView()3、点击事件 @Override public void onClick(View v)4、退出此Activity时保存users @Override public void onPau

2016-03-05 23:18:00 523

原创 GuideMap 登陆界面 详细文档(二)

三、User 用户数据的数据类型 1、用户数据 private String account=”未登录”; private String password; private String name=”没有名称”; private String phone; private String ma

2016-03-05 23:08:34 373

原创 GuideMap 登陆界面 详细文档(一)

登录界面文档主要类:LoginActivity 登录类 RegisterActivity 注册类 untils/VolleyIO Volley工具类 untils/VolleyInterface Volley接口 untils/UserLoginSave 保存账户名类 MyApplic

2016-03-05 23:02:11 940

原创 颜色大合集 xml文件

<?xml version="1.0" encoding="utf-8" ?><resources> <color name="white">#FFFFFF</color><!--白色 --> <color name="ivory">#FFFFF0</color><!--象牙色 --> <color name="lightyellow">#FFFFE0</color><!-

2016-02-21 17:57:48 553

原创 intent启动新activity / 使用其他类的方法

比如按下一个按钮启动新activityIntent intent=new Intent(); intent.setClass(this,NewActivity.class); startActivity(intent);使用其他类的方法 比如在某个类中使用VolleyIO类的JsonGet方法new VolleyIO().JsonGe

2016-02-21 17:53:10 1071

转载 xml align 边缘对齐语句 等

android:layout_above=”@id/xxx” –将控件置于给定ID控件之上 android:layout_below=”@id/xxx” –将控件置于给定ID控件之下 android:layout_toLeftOf=”@id/xxx” –将控件的右边缘和给定ID控件的左边缘对齐 android:layout_toRightOf=”@id/xxx” –将控件的左边缘和给定

2016-02-20 00:23:46 1144

原创 ActionBar研究日志

ActionBar 研究日志:1:在onCreate中对ActionBar进行操作,比如隐藏ActionBar。出现空指针异常ActionBar actionBar = getActionBar(); actionBar.hide(); 使用这个包android.support.v7.app.ActionBar里的actionbar 变为android.support.v7.app.Acti

2016-01-22 02:32:29 312

原创 GuideMap开发记录 1

高德地图开发记录: 1/16: BasicMapActivity:显示地图。 出现SuperNotCalledException:错误,原来是onCreate中少了super。以后当注意不要随意修改基类自带super.xx。public class BasicMapActivity extends Activity{ private MapView ma

2016-01-16 15:35:20 536

原创 Volley--慕课网学习

Volley是谷歌发布的提供的网络通讯库。一、Volley提供:1、GET,POST网络请求和网络图像的高效的异步处理请求2、网络请求优先级的排序3、网络请求的缓存4、多级别取消请求5、和Activity生命周期的联动优点:高效的GET/POST数据请求交互,网络图片的加载和缓存。           谷歌官方推出,性能稳定高效缺点:不适合文件的上传与下

2015-12-26 21:52:00 291

转载 Android ApI 搬运【Intent】

Intent 和 Intent 过滤器本文内容Intent 类型构建 Intent显式 Intent 示例隐式 Intent 示例强制使用应用选择器接收隐式 Intent过滤器示例使用待定 IntentIntent 解析操作测试类别测试数据测试Intent 匹配另请参阅与其他应用交互共享内容Intent

2015-11-26 12:47:07 341

原创 AsyncTask同步加载基础

学习 http://www.imooc.com/learn/377 笔记异步任务:由于Android单线程模型,只有主线程即UI线程可以对UI进行操作,然而一些耗时任务必须放在非主线程中进行。AsyncTask是一个Android封装好的组件用于进行异步任务处理。用处:在子线程中更新UI,封装简化异步操作一个典型的AsyncTask使用:public class

2015-11-19 15:24:51 755

原创 利用ViewHolder优化BaseAdapter(ListView)

学习http://www.imooc.com/video/7080有关BaseAdapter的代码及注释笔记目的:使用ListView列表界面时为了更有效率,下拉等滑动更为平滑,使用一些优化措施。思路:1.创建Bean对象,用于封装数据          2.在MyAdapter构造方法中初始化用于映射的数据List          3.创建ViewHolder类,与布局形成

2015-11-19 10:06:35 390

转载 《第一行代码》第二章/Toast,Menu,Intent

1:Toast:      Toast是一个提醒消息框,用于将一些短小的信息通知给用户,不占用屏幕空间,而且会在一段时间后自动消失。例子Toast.makeText(this, "xxxxxxx", Toast.LENGTH_SHORT).show();参数:(context上下文,"文本信息",toast显示时长)2:menu:     在res/menu/目录下

2015-10-28 10:28:06 761

转载 侧滑菜单滑动特效学习笔记

学习贴:http://blog.csdn.net/guolin_blog/article/details/8714621mainActivity:package com.example.renrenslidemenudemo;import android.support.v7.app.ActionBarActivity;import android.content.Context;

2015-10-27 16:37:58 327

原创 《第一行代码》读书笔记:第十三章/进阶技巧(未完)

1:全局获取Context。Android中有一个Application类,程序启动时它会初始化。我们通过定制自己的Application来管理一些全局的状态信息,如Context。public class MyApplication extends Application{//全局获取Context private static Context context; @Ove

2015-10-26 16:53:25 363

原创 《第一行代码》读书笔记:第十一章/位置服务

基本步骤:1:要使用LocationManager就要先获取它的实例,通过调用getSystemService()方法可以获取到private LocationManager locationManager;locationManager=(LocationManager)getSystemService(Context.LOCATION_SERVICE);2:Android有三种

2015-10-26 15:57:48 337

原创 《第一行代码》读书笔记:第十二章/传感器的用法

《第一行代码》读书笔记:第十一章/传感器的用法

2015-10-26 15:47:11 292

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除